Air to liquid heat transfer uses Shell & Tube Heat Exchangers Brazetek carries an extensive selection of shell and tube heat exchangers - ST series are all-316L Stainless Steel Custom Heat Exchangers XchangerThis stainless steel heat exchanger cools air from 70 deg F to -150 deg F using liquid nitrogen. Its used in by a food manufacturing company, in their test facility.The nitrogen evaporates at -280 deg F inside the 1/2 O.D. copper tubes. The air flows vertically downward through the heat exchanger.

Also known as shell and tube heat exchangers, they flow liquid or steam through their outer shell to heat or cool liquid in the inner tubes. Made of 316 stainless steel, they have excellent corrosion resistance. The tubes are removable so they can be sanitized separately from the shell, and their polished interior makes it easy to clean out residue.
